Open the carrier accounts page

In the Carriyo Dashboard, open Settings in the left sidebar. Under Carrier Management, choose Carrier Accounts, then click the + add icon to start a new account.

Enter the basics

The first wizard page collects two fields:

Account name
A label that's meaningful to your team (e.g. PostNL Netherlands). Keep it short and unique.
Account country
The country this account ships from. Determines the routes and services available.

All PostNL settings

Every field PostNL exposes in the carrier account, grouped by section. Carriyo stores secrets encrypted and never shows them after saving.

Authentication

1 field

Account identifiers and API credentials used to connect to the carrier.

FieldTypeWhat to enter
API KeyRequiredSecretYour PostNL API key; generate it in the PostNL Customer Portal under API management.
Example: DUQI4LbWHAAEb1BYHTScVmOifHKcBNTh

Account Details

4 fields

Account-level configuration and defaults applied to shipments.

FieldTypeWhat to enter
Customer CodeRequiredTextYour PostNL customer code (the alphabetic prefix on barcodes), provided when your account is set up.
Example: BPEG
Customer NumberRequiredTextYour numeric PostNL customer number.
Example: 65297126
Collection LocationRequiredTextThe PostNL collection location code where parcels are tendered.
Example: 655093
Product Code DeliveryRequiredTextDefault PostNL product code that sets the delivery service (e.g. 3085 for standard domestic).
Example: 8530

Capability notes

Behavior that follows from PostNL's capabilities. Read these before you go live.

Status via polling
This carrier has no push callback. Carriyo polls on a schedule, so tracking can lag the carrier's own system by a few minutes.
No rate API
Carrier Shipping Rates has no effect here. Attach a costing profile to set the shipment cost.
